Rep. Chip Roy On The Appointment of John Ratcliffe

July 29, 2019

Rep. Chip Roy released the following statement Monday morning on the appointment of Rep. John Ratcliffe to become the next Director of National Intelligence:

I am thrilled to see that President Donald Trump is appointing my friend and colleague John Ratcliffe to become the next Director of National Intelligence. A patriot with the track record to prove it, John has served his country with honor for decades and I have no doubt our nation is in good hands with him at the helm of the Office of National Intelligence.

Before becoming a member of Congress, John served as a U.S. Attorney and federal terrorism prosecutor, putting terrorists in prison and defending American sovereignty both at home and abroad. While in Congress, John has served on both the Intelligence, Homeland Security, and Judiciary committees, giving him insights into the threats our nation faces and how best to tackle strategically address them in order to defend the United States of America.

I have zero doubt John will do a fantastic job and wish him all the best as he goes through the confirmation process in the Senate.
